The Bachelor’s degree in Genetics at Iowa State University provides a solid foundation in the principles of heredity, molecular biology, and genomics. Students will explore the genetic basis of traits in organisms, including plants, animals, and humans. The curriculum integrates courses in biology, chemistry, and mathematics to equip students with the necessary skills for understanding genetic information and its applications.
Throughout the program, students engage in hands-on laboratory experiences that build critical thinking and problem-solving skills. This program emphasizes both theoretical knowledge and practical application, allowing students to conduct genetic experiments and analyze data using modern techniques and technologies. Students are encouraged to participate in research projects, which often lead to opportunities for publishing findings and presenting at scientific conferences.
Graduating with a degree in Genetics opens doors to diverse career paths in agriculture, p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, and healthcare. Students learn to communicate scientific ideas effectively, making them valuable assets in various roles that require teamwork and collaboration.
Typical academic prerequisites for admission into the Genetics program include a high school diploma with a strong background in science and mathematics. Courses in biology, chemistry, and calculus are highly recommended to ensure students are well-prepared for the rigor of college-level genetics coursework.
Students whose first language is not English are generally required to demonstrate proficiency in English through standardized testing such as TOEFL or IELTS. A minimum score of 80 on the TOEFL or a 6.5 on the IELTS is commonly expected, but students should verify specific requirements with the university.
International students must apply for an F-1 visa and are required to obtain an I-20 form, which is issued by Iowa State University after acceptance into the program. Additionally, students must maintain SEVIS compliance throughout their studies in the U.S.
